How to Choose and Use Your Perfect Planning App

“Optimist You”: “There are so many amazing options out there—I’m sure one will be perfect!”
“Grumpy You”: “Yeah, right. Half those reviews look like they’re written by bots. What now?”

  1. Assess Your Needs

    Do you need something minimalist or feature-packed? Do you prioritize visual scheduling or text-based simplicity? Think about whether you want integrations like Google Calendar or widgets for quick access.

  2. Pick Based on Workflow

    If you’re team OCD, Trello’s boards might speak to your soul. If you love gamified systems, give Habitica a spin—it turns productivity into an RPG adventure complete with rewards and quests.

  3. Test Before Committing

    Treat yourself to a free trial period. Most apps come with freemium models, letting you experiment risk-free before committing your hard-earned cash.

Top Time Crafting Hacks for Peak Productivity

A few clever tips make all the difference:

  1. Use Time Blocking: Allocate specific chunks of time for each task rather than floating aimlessly between them.
  2. Create Visual Cues: Color-code projects or deadlines to trigger action immediately.
  3. Terrific Terrible Tip: Ignore notifications entirely… unless you enjoy drowning in pings every five seconds. Trust me, no good comes from checking email during lunch.

Frequently Asked Questions About Time Management Tools

Which app is best for beginners?

Anytime Planner Beginner Kit™ probably doesn’t exist, but we recommend starting with Notion due to its versatility and user-friendly interface.

Can I integrate fitness trackers with planning apps?

Some apps, like Habitify, sync seamlessly with wearable tech to track both movement and mindfulness activities.

Are these apps worth the money?

Honestly? Free versions often suffice, but premium subscriptions unlock advanced features that could justify the cost depending on your needs.
